Output 86f8b2524bcea12b5e20447496d14b3a1f087f5f95713afe74f0afc568eb4866:40

value
1445416
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a41554a3d6eaa2bb72c41032f0fa8398423c474 OP_EQUAL
address
DLfKgJCp5uw98gJwCZ8EBK2iwqEdTxAYDj
transaction
86f8b2524bcea12b5e20447496d14b3a1f087f5f95713afe74f0afc568eb4866
spent
true